#53672c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#53672c is composed of 32.5% red, 40.4%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 57.3% yellow and 59.6% black. It has a hue angle of 80.3 degrees, a saturation of 40.1% and a lightness of 28.8%. #53672c color hex could be obtained by blending #a6ce58 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#53672c color description : Very dark desaturated green.

#53672c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#53672c has RGB values of R:83, G:103, B:44 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0, Y:0.57,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 5465900.

Shades and Tints of #53672c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050703 is the darkest color, while #fbfcf8 is the lightest one.
